What will the weather in Davenport be like during my trip?
September and August are typically the warmest months in Davenport when the average temp is 63°F. February and March are the coldest months when the average temperature is 52°F. January and December are the months with the most rain.

Unwind in Davenport: Where Coastal Serenity Meets Vibrant Culture

Nestled along the breathtaking California coast, Davenport is a charming coastal gem that invites adventure and tranquility. This quaint village boasts dramatic cliffs, pristine beaches, and the scenic beauty of the Pacific Ocean. Explore the iconic Davenport Beach, perfect for sunbathing and tide pooling, or wander through the lush landscapes of nearby redwood forests. Don’t miss the historic Davenport Pier, where stunning sunsets paint the sky. With its laid-back vibe and captivating vistas, Davenport is an ideal off-the-beaten-path destination for nature lovers and romantic getaways alike. Discover the essence of coastal California in this hidden paradise.

Top locations to stay in Davenport

When visiting Davenport, California, consider staying in Santa Cruz, Scotts Valley, or Felton. Santa Cruz is perfect for walking along beautiful beaches, Scotts Valley offers a tranquil escape with easy access to outdoor activities, and Felton is ideal for camping and exploring redwood forests. For first-time visitors, Santa Cruz is the best option due to its vibrant atmosphere and coastal attractions.

  1. Santa CruzOpens in a new window: Santa Cruz is a vibrant coastal city known for its stunning beaches and lively boardwalk. It offers a fantastic mix of outdoor activities, including walking along the scenic coastline and enjoying the local surf culture. The Santa Cruz Beach Boardwalk is a must-visit for its classic amusement park rides and oceanfront attractions. The city is also home to a thriving arts scene, with numerous galleries and cultural events to explore. Plus, you'll find plenty of shopping options in the downtown area, where unique boutiques and local shops line the streets.
  2. Scotts ValleyOpens in a new window: Just a short drive from Santa Cruz, Scotts Valley provides a quieter retreat with a charming, small-town feel. The area is perfect for those who love nature, offering easy access to hiking trails and picturesque parks. The local shopping scene features quaint shops and convenient services, making it a pleasant spot to unwind after a day of exploration. Scotts Valley is also known for its community events and festivals, adding a local flavor to your visit.
  3. FeltonOpens in a new window: Nestled in the redwoods, Felton is a hidden gem for nature lovers and those seeking a peaceful getaway. It’s the perfect base for outdoor adventures, with nearby camping and hiking opportunities in Henry Cowell Redwoods State Park. Felton’s charming downtown area features local shops and cafes, providing a cozy atmosphere to relax. The community vibe here is welcoming, making it easy to connect with locals and immerse yourself in the area's natural beauty.

Things to do in Davenport

Davenport enchants visitors with its stunning coastline, inviting beaches, and lush parks. Enjoy sun-soaked days by the water, explore scenic trails through vibrant forests, and unwind in serene lakeside spots. As the sun sets, the lively nightlife offers a blend of cozy bars and energetic venues, making it a delightful retreat for all.

  • Capitola BeachOpens in a new window – Relax on the sandy shores of Capitola Beach, where you can soak up the sun, build sandcastles, or take a refreshing dip in the ocean. This charming beach offers stunning views and a laid-back atmosphere, perfect for a family day out or a leisurely stroll along the coast.
  • Santa Cruz Beach BoardwalkOpens in a new window – Experience the thrill of rides and games at the Santa Cruz Beach Boardwalk, a bustling amusement park right by the beach. With its classic wooden roller coaster and a variety of attractions, it’s a great place to create lasting memories with friends and family while enjoying seaside snacks.
  • Mystery SpotOpens in a new window – Discover the quirky allure of the Mystery Spot, an intriguing exhibit that challenges your perceptions of gravity and space. Join a guided tour to explore this fascinating location, where optical illusions and oddities await, making it a fun stop for curious minds of all ages.
  • Roaring Camp RailroadsOpens in a new window – Hop aboard a historic train at Roaring Camp Railroads and journey through the majestic redwoods. This scenic ride provides a unique perspective of the towering trees and the beautiful landscape, blending a touch of history with the natural wonders of California.

Best time to go to Davenport

Davenport experiences its lowest average temperatures in February, and December, at 52.0°F (11.1°C), while September is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 64.0°F (17.8°C). January is usually the wettest month. April, June, and July are the peak travel months in Davenport,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is sunny to mostly sunny, accompanied by no rainfall. On the other hand, October to December t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by no to light rainfall and sunny to mostly sunny conditions.
